According to the management system, popular science periodicals in China can be divided into two kinds, local popular science periodicals and imported popular science periodicals. They have differences in image type. These differences affect the dissemination of scientific information. This paper takes Knowledge Is Power, Encyclopedic Knowledge, Universal Science, Newton Scientific World as examples to analyze the difference of information representation, information explanation and information supplement, all of these will be useful for the development of popular science periodicals.
